1. SPECIFICATIONS

English

[Setting]

This drive is Horizontal and Vertical Use.

[Disc Size]

• 12 cm (4.72”) / 8 cm (3.15”)*
* 8 cm (3.15") discs cannot be used at upright position.

[Data Transfer Rate]

Data Read (Sustained)
DVD .......................................................... Max. 22.16 MBytes/sec.
CD ............................................................ Max. 6.14 MBytes/sec.

(17.1 – 40X CAV Mode over 16 block transfer)

Data Write (Sustained)
DVD .......................................................... Ave. 22.16 MBytes/sec. (16X DVD-R)
CD ............................................................ Ave. 4.92 MBytes/sec. (32X CD-R)
Host Interface specification
PIO Mode 4, Multi word DMA Mode 2 ...... 16.6 MBytes/sec.
Ultra DMA Mode 4 .................................... 66.6 MBytes/sec.
• The data transfer rate may not be output due to disc conditions (scratches, etc.).

[Access Time/ Seek Time]

Access time (Random average)
DVD-ROM 1 ............................................. 40 ms CD-ROM 130 ms
Seek time (Random average)
DVD-ROM 1 ............................................. 20 ms CD-ROM 100 ms

[Others]

Power Supply ........................................... DC +12 V, 0.9 A

DC +5 V, 1.4 A

Dimensions ............................................... 148 (W) x 42.3 (H) x 198 (D) mm

(including front panel) 5-27/32 (W) x 1-11/16 (H) x 7-25/32 (D) in.

Weight ...................................................... 1.1 kg (2.43 lb)
